    Me rex Newbie around these forums really. Currently drive (well technically it's SORN now) a 1994 Mazda RX7 Type R2. Not many mods really. HKS Racing Suction intakes, HKS Super Drager catback, Sparco Steering Wheel and gear knob, Alpine stereo, HKS Coilovers and that's about it.

    Currently off the road for a rebuild, porting, fuel upgrades etc etc. Full 3" exhaust system first from SMB Exhausts in Australia then the rebuild, then the porting, then see how much money I have for other odds and sods

    This is my wife's car. It's a temporary thing while we wait to see where we are going to live next. It's an 2001 SL500, and it's in quite a nice metallic grey. It goes pretty well and is a very nice drive. A bit wasted in the city though.



    My car is a different proposition completely. I have a 1993 BMW E32 740i. I paid 4,000 Euros for it in 2003 so it is worthless now. I had it dyno-tested back in Luxembourg (it's free as part of the 'MOT' if you ask) and it still produces 282bhp) it has the 4.4 litre M60 engine, so it was originally sold in the USA.

    A funny thing happened to me just after I bought it. I was driving out of the Grund (Luxembourgish for "Ground", the name of a little village in a pit) under one of Luxembourg's immense bridges when some prankster dropped a water balloon on me. Hah! Hah!, how I sniggered!

    The Viaduct is some 32 metres above the road. The balloon probably contained about 500gms of water and thus weighed about 500gms (or just over a pound to you non-Europeans), Upon being released it accelerated at 9.8 metres per second2 So, after 32 metres it had accelerated to about 30 m/s. This is equivalent to around 108 Km/Hour. It is a steep hill, but I have 300bhp and use it, so I was doing 80kph uphill when the balloon hit the windscreen. Allowing for the angle of impact I figure that 500gms of water hit my windscreen at a combined speed of 180kph or about 110 mph.

    Can you imagine what would happen if a baseball or a cricket ball hit your windscreen if it had been bowled at that speed? Well, this water balloon weighed twice as much, but it wasn't as hard. Can you guess what won, the glass or the water?
